One of the most compelling aspects of the Happy Threads tulip set is its environmental character. These flowers are made from yarn rather than plastic, which places them in an entirely different category from most artificial flowers on the market.
The artificial flower industry has historically relied heavily on plastic — polyethylene, polyester, and similar materials that are cheap to produce but create significant environmental burdens. Plastic flowers do not biodegrade, are difficult to recycle, and are often produced in manufacturing processes that generate substantial waste and emissions.
Yarn-based crochet flowers offer a genuinely different profile. The materials are more sustainable, the production is artisanal rather than industrial, and the longevity of the product means that one set of crochet tulips can replace many cycles of fresh flowers or cheap plastic alternatives. From a lifecycle perspective, investing in a set of crochet flowers that will last for years is a meaningfully more sustainable choice than buying fresh flowers every few weeks or replacing plastic arrangements annually.

Caring for Your Crochet Tulips
One of the great pleasures of owning crochet flowers is how little they ask of you. There is no watering schedule, no need for sunlight, no trimming of stems, no watching for wilting. You simply place them where you want them and let them be beautiful.
If the flowers collect dust over time, a gentle shake or a light pass with a soft brush is all that is needed to refresh them. They can also be spot-cleaned with a damp cloth if needed. The yarn material holds its color well, so the vivid red that makes these tulips so striking will remain vibrant for years with minimal effort.
